American woman brutally killed in Mexico in horrific case of mistaken identity

An American woman was brutally shot dead in Mexico after cartel members mistook her dad's Ford F-150 for that of a rival gang. Isabel Ashanti Gómez, 22, was traveling home with her father Valentín and friend Dánae, 26, from a dance when they came across an unofficial checkpoint believed to have been set up by the Jalisco Nueva Generación Cartel (CJNG). After noticing the criminals, her father decided not to stop and the alleged criminal opened fire in the early hours of Sunday morning, believing the group were rival gang members, TV Azteca reported. Gómez was shot and killed. Her father and her friend were both seriously injured and rushed to the hospital. The shooting was linked to William Edwin Rivera Padilla, who goes by the alias 'El Barbas,' preliminary reports said, TV Azteca reported. Padilla is a regional lieutenant of the gang. No one has been arrested for Gómez's death. Valentín had offered to pick up the girls after the event ran over and it had grown late. On the way back, they came across the checkpoint on the Zitácuaro-Aputzio highway in Juárez. Police are still investigating the shooting. Gomez was a dual US-Mexico citizen and often visited the country. Just hours before her death, Gómez had posted a video of herself and her uncle dancing and wished him a happy birthday. 'I hope you keep celebrating many more birthdays. See you later, after I've had a shower,' she wrote. May Mendoza, who is in a civil union with Gómez, wrote on Facebook: 'I will always carry you in my heart my beautiful girl.' She also changed her Facebook cover photo to Gómez's eyes. A funeral for Gómez took place earlier this week. Several wreaths of flowers and photos of her were seen near her white and gold casket. Cartels are prevalent in Mexico and they control drug routes and more. It is estimated that around 300,000 people work for Mexico's cartels. CNJC emerged from the Milenio Cartel around 2010 and is known for its aggression. It is one of Mexico's leading criminal threats, according to Insight Crime. In 2015, the gang killed 15 Mexican police officers in an ambush, which was one of the deadliest attacks on law enforcement in the country. A month later, they shot down a police helicopter. The cartel has also made attempts at killing public figures, such as Former Security Secretary Luis Carlos Nájera in 2018 and Public Security Secretary Omar García Harfuch in 2020. The US government has offered a $10million reward for information leading to the arrest of the group's leader Nemesio Oseguera Ramos, who goes by the alias 'El Mencho.'

Clinical Study Finds CURCUSHINE™ Microcapsules Effective in Beauty-From-Within Applications

BARCELONA, Spain--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Lubrizol's CURCUSHINE™ microcapsules microencapsulated curcumin ingredient was found to deliver improved skin radiance, reduced wrinkle depth and other skin benefits in a newly released clinical study. The study, demonstrating strong evidence for the efficacy of CURCUSHINE™ for beauty-from-within nutraceutical applications, was published in the Agro FOOD Industry hi-tech journal. Lubrizol will present the results of the study at our booth, #4F10, at Vitafoods Europe 2025, held in Barcelona from May 20-22. The CURCUSHINE™ clinical study tested 63 women between the ages of 21 to 50 who said they had facial skin imperfections. Participants consumed CURCUSHINE™ microcapsules or a placebo daily for 42 days. Participants who took CURCUSHINE™ microcapsules were reported to have improved skin radiance, reduced wrinkle depth, and enhanced overall skin appearance in just six weeks, including: An increase in skin luminosity by up to 19%, and skin homogeneity by up to 69% An improvement in the L* parameter (degree of brightness) for facial skin A reduction in dark spots of up to 8% A reduction of the wrinkle volume in the outer corners of the eyes, known as the crow's feet region, by 10.32% on average A reduction in wrinkle volume in the forehead area by an average of 5.14% The findings build on a previous in vitro study that highlighted the ability of CURCUSHINE™ microcapsules to shield collagen and elastin from oxidative and inflammatory damage. CURCUSHINE™ microcapsules is a powerful beauty-from-within ingredient, capable of enhancing skin luminosity and uniform skin tone. Its unique microencapsulation process enhances the dispersibility of curcumin in water and increases its bioavailability, making it an easy-to-formulate nutricosmetic ingredient that may provide a protective effect on skin structures when supplemented regularly alongside a standard diet. CURCUSHINE™ microencapsulated curcumin has a neutral taste and water dispersibility. CURCUSHINE™ curcumin microcapsules can be incorporated into various nutraceutical and nutricosmetic applications, including tablets, capsules, gummies, powder sachets, and functional beverages.
